Given

a²+8a+16

To find

Factors of given polynomial

Solution

\implies\red{a^2+8a+16}

we have to break the middile term in such a way that the the sum become 8

And multiple be 16

Therefore

\implies\green{a^2+4a+4a+16}

\implies\yellow{a(a+4)+4(a+4)}

\implies\brown{(a+4)(a+4}

Hence the factor will be\brown{(a+4)(a+4)}
